In February of 2016, Pennsylvania Governor Tom Wolf signed in to law Pennsylvania Senate Bill 166, broadening Pennsylvania Expungement Law. The new expungement law creates 9122.1. The new Pennsylvania Expungement Law creates a new class of expungements. Most misdemeanors of the second and third degree are…
